Crown Magnetar have premiered a new video for their new song “Barbed Wire Noose.” This track is from the band’s new EP “Punishment,” which will be released on March 7. Vocalist Dan Tucker commented: “’Barbed Wire Noose’ will be the third song released from our upcoming EP, ‘Punishment’, and continues our deliverance of relentless, in-your-face…